Description

Based on Grace Metalious' best-selling novel, Peyton Place received an impressive nine Oscar nominations in 1957, including Best Picture. Lana Turner's acclaimed performance as Constance MacKenzie, the single mother of a beautiful teen (Diane Varsi), earned her a Best Actress nomination (Varsi received Best Supporting Actress consideration as well). While Constance and the other parents in a picture-perfect New Hampshire town strive to keep their teenagers on the straight and narrow, scandals take place around them: A drunken school caretaker (Arthur Kennedy, nominated for Best Supporting Actor) traumatizes his stepdaughter, which prompts a murder, a trial and the revelation that nothing is as it seems in this beautifully photographed, spell-binding drama filled with top-notch performances.
